When it comes to constructing durable and efficient structures on your property, the choice of material plays a pivotal role. Concrete stands out as a superior option compared to wood or metal for various applications, including steps, retaining walls, and even entire homes. Here’s why concrete should be your material of choice:
- Durability and Longevity
Concrete structures are renowned for their exceptional durability. Unlike wood, which can rot, warp, or be infested by termites, and metal, which is prone to rust and corrosion, concrete withstands the test of time with minimal maintenance. This longevity ensures that structures like steps, patios, and driveways remain functional and aesthetically pleasing for decades.
- Enhanced Safety
Concrete is non-combustible, making it a safer choice for structures, especially in areas prone to wildfires. Its fire-resistant properties can provide valuable time during emergencies, potentially saving lives and property.
- Energy Efficiency
The thermal mass of concrete allows it to absorb and retain heat, leading to increased energy efficiency in buildings. This characteristic helps in maintaining consistent indoor temperatures, reducing the need for excessive heating or cooling, and thereby lowering energy bills.
- Resistance to Environmental Factors
Concrete structures offer superior resistance to environmental challenges such as wind, water, and pests. This resilience makes concrete an ideal choice for retaining walls, foundations, and other structures exposed to the elements.
- Low Maintenance
Once installed, concrete structures require minimal upkeep compared to their wood or metal counterparts. This low maintenance aspect translates to cost savings over time and less effort in preserving the appearance and functionality of your property.
- Versatility in Design
Modern concrete can be molded into various shapes and finishes, offering versatility in design. Whether you desire decorative concrete steps, stamped concrete patios, or custom-designed retaining walls, concrete provides the flexibility to achieve your aesthetic goals.
- Cost-Effectiveness
While the initial investment in concrete may be higher than wood, its durability and low maintenance requirements make it a cost-effective choice in the long run. Additionally, concrete’s resistance to natural disasters can lead to lower insurance premiums.
Applications Where Concrete Excels
- Steps and Staircases: Concrete steps offer a sturdy, slip-resistant surface that can withstand heavy foot traffic and harsh weather conditions.
- Retaining Walls: Ideal for managing soil erosion and creating leveled landscapes, concrete retaining walls provide strength and durability.
- Driveways and Patios: Concrete surfaces can handle the weight of vehicles and outdoor furniture without cracking or sinking, ensuring a long-lasting and attractive addition to your property.
- Foundations and Basements: Concrete provides a solid foundation for homes and buildings, offering resistance to moisture and structural integrity.
